Nick Saban responds to question about potential return of two key Bama LBs
By Cody McClure
Published:
Nick Saban was reportedly asked on Thursday if he expects to get any Crimson Tide linebackers back for the Iron Bowl next Saturday.
Alabama is depleted with injuries at the position as it heads into the final two weeks of the season.
“I don’t know where that’s coming from,” the Tide head coach said. “Those guys haven’t been medically cleared yet. … I don’t know if we’ll get those guys back for the game next week or not.
“Though we could use them.”
That final line from Saban may be quite telling. How worried should Alabama fans be that the Crimson Tide is wearing thin on tacklers?
Keith Holcombe and Dylan Moses have been trying to hold down the fort, but there has been some speculation that Christian Miller and Terrell Lewis — both of whom have been out since Week 1 — could be ready to go by the time the top-ranked Tide travels to battle No. 6 Auburn.
Even Saban’s teams, which always have steady depth, can be tested by the injury bug.
